The report of the Local Government Commission of Inquiry will be published before end of August, the government has announced.
The report of the commission which investigated the conduct of local councils across the country would be made public alongside a cabinet “White Paper” outlining the government’s response to its findings and recommendations.
The disclosure was made by the Minister for Lands, Regional Government and Religious Affairs Hamat N.K. Bah during a question-and-answer session at the National Assembly on Wednesday.
Responding to a question from Banjul Central NAM Abdoulie Njai, the minister said the commission, established under Section 200 of the Constitution and the Commission of Inquiry Act, had already submitted its report to President Adama Barrow after examining the affairs of local government councils between May 2018 and January 2023.
He explained that government is currently reviewing the report and preparing a White Paper that will provide its official position on the commission’s findings and recommendations.
According to the minister, the review process includes legal analysis of accountability issues in relation to the Local Government Act, Public Finance Act and other relevant laws before policy decisions are taken.
“The Government has taken receipt of the Commission’s report and is currently preparing a White Paper setting out the Government’s considered response,” he told lawmakers.
The minister further informed members that both the report and the White Paper would be tabled before the National Assembly and subsequently published for public consumption before the end of August.
Lawmakers pressed government on whether recommendations from the inquiry would be implemented, citing concerns over previous commissions whose findings were never fully acted upon.
In response, the minister assured members that government remains committed to implementing recommendations in accordance with the law but noted that the implementation timeline would only become clear after the White Paper is completed.
The Local Government Commission of Inquiry was tasked with investigating the management and operations of local councils across the country, making its findings one of the most anticipated public accountability reports in recent years.
